Instructions
To a 15-inch skillet or large pot over medium-high heat, add 3 tablespoons oil. Once hot, add onions, bell peppers, and jalapeno peppers. Cook 5-8 minutes, or until soft.
Add garlic. Cook for 1 minute.
Reduce heat to medium. Add pulled pork, paprika, salt, pepper, and 3 tablespoons of remaining oil. Add hash browns and fry for 25 minutes, or until crispy, stirring every few minutes. Meanwhile, make the scrambled eggs.
When ready, add 1 cup of shredded cheese to the pulled pork mixture, stirring to combine.
Stir in scrambled eggs. Sprinkle the remaining ½ cup cheese on top.
Salt and pepper, to taste. Garnish with a few sliced jalapenos (optional). Serve hot.
